## Deployment

The Liftwright simulator deploys as a single stateless binary behind the Cartwell scheduler. Build artifacts are produced by the release pipeline and must be promoted manually from staging; never deploy a commit that has not passed the full cab-dispatch regression suite. Each environment reads one config file at boot, and changes require a restart. The staging values we currently run with are listed below.

config for kafof-bawef:
holath:
  log_level: debug
  metrics_host: metrics.holath.qorvelsys.internal
  pin: 2191
  pool_size: 32

Handover note — from Celeste to Arvind, re: the Pembrook franchise agreement. Royalties are 6% on gross, paid monthly; the Dalewick group is current but always ten days late, so don't panic. Renewal window opens in March. Legal already blessed the template for new territories. Keep the next bit to yourselves, finance folks.

confidential, bagap-yagug: Jorethek Foods plans to raise the Kelys list price by 61.0 percent in November. The pricing group signed off on a budget of $62.2 million for Project Briix. The renewal with Fraethax Holdings closes at $400.6 million a year, 23.6 percent below the last contract. Project Praax slips by six weeks because of the staffing delay.

## Health Checks — Marrowgate Edge

The Marrowgate load balancer probes each backend on a dedicated health endpoint, separate from application routes. A backend is drained after three consecutive failures and re-added after two successes. Probes bypass authentication, so the endpoint must never expose data. If an instance flaps, check disk pressure first — it's the usual cause. The balancer applies the following health-check configuration values.

config for yahag-tagag:
oliael:
  log_level: info
  metrics_host: metrics.oliael.tolvaqsys.internal
  pin: 4558
  pool_size: 8

The first-aid room at Quillstone House is on Level 2, beside the print hub. Team assistants should check the supply cabinet each Monday and log anything used. The defibrillator stays on the wall bracket at all times. The room is kept locked outside business hours, so use the door code below.

staff pass of kawip-hawef = bdg-QLP-2